Device for temporarily storing automobile fuel tank cap in gas station

By installing a fuel tank cap storage bracket on the fuel nozzle, the problem of temporary fuel tank cap storage is solved, enabling convenient and safe fuel tank cap management and improving the service quality and safety of gas stations.

Abstract

The utility model relates to the field of refueling equipment, in particular to an automobile fuel tank cap temporary storage device for a gas station, which is characterized in that a fuel tank cap storage bracket is mounted on a refueling gun body and comprises a fuel tank cap storage bearing platform and a fuel tank cap storage device connector; the fuel tank cap storage bearing platform is of a semicircular structure and is used for placing an automobile fuel tank cap; the fuel tank cap storage device connector is arranged below the fuel tank cap storage bearing platform, a clamping part is arranged at the bottom of the fuel tank cap storage device connector, and the fuel tank cap storage bracket is installed on the fuel gun body. The device is convenient and stable to install, long-term reliable use of the device is guaranteed, the operation convenience is improved, a refueling worker does not need to find a fuel tank cap placing position, the device can be used on a fuel gun during refueling, and the process is simplified. And after refueling is finished, the fuel tank cover can be taken out from the semicircular opening of the storage bracket to be installed in the vehicle fuel tank, the whole device enters a standby state immediately, recycling can be achieved, refueling operation every time can be efficiently and conveniently served, and the use cost is reduced.

TECHNICAL FIELD

[0001] The utility model relates to oiling equipment field, concretely relates to a device is accomodate temporarily to oil station temporary accomodation car oil tank cover. BACKGROUND

[0002] In today's highly developed era of transportation, as one of the most important means of transportation, the operation service of the oil station plays a crucial connecting role. The oil station not only undertakes the key task of providing fuel supply for various vehicles, but also directly affects the travel experience of the vehicle owner and traffic safety and many other aspects.

[0003] However, in the daily refueling process, the temporary storage of the car fuel tank cover has brought many troubles to the vehicle owner and the oil station staff. At present, many vehicles cannot properly store the removed fuel tank cover due to design defects or damage to the original fuel tank cover storage device. The vehicle owner often has to choose to hold the fuel tank cover, which will bring great inconvenience when operating the refueling gun, affecting the refueling efficiency; or place the fuel tank cover randomly on the vehicle body, fuel dispenser, multifunctional cabinet, etc. This not only easily leads to the fuel tank cover being forgotten at the oil station, causing property loss, but also may cause the fuel tank cover to be contaminated with dust, soil and other impurities, which may be brought into the fuel system when reinstalled, affecting engine performance, and even becoming roadside garbage, increasing environmental cleaning costs. More seriously, if the vehicle owner does not correctly install the fuel tank cover before driving, it may cause fuel leakage, and in the flammable environment of the oil station, it is extremely likely to cause a fire or other serious accidents, posing a great threat to life and property safety. In addition, when faced with the situation of no place to put the fuel tank cover, the oil station staff needs to spend extra time helping customers find, store or remind to install the fuel tank cover, which undoubtedly reduces the service efficiency and quality of the entire refueling process, especially during the peak refueling period, which may exacerbate the queuing phenomenon.

[0004] In order to solve the problems existing in the prior art, it is necessary to develop a car fuel tank cover temporary storage device specially adapted to the oil station scene, which can realize fast access, accurate prevention of misoperation, and flexible compatibility with different sizes and shapes of fuel tank covers, providing solid support for the fine and standardized management of the oil station. SUMMARY

[0005] In order to solve the above problems of the prior art, the utility model provides an oil station temporary accomodation car oil tank cover device, which installs an oil tank cover storage bracket on the gun body of the refueling gun to realize convenient storage of the fuel tank cover.

[0006] Specifically, the utility model provides an oil station temporary accomodation car oil tank cover device, which comprises: an oil tank cover storage platform, an oil tank cover storage device connecting port;

[0007] The oil tank cover receiving support is a semicircular structure for placing the oil tank cover of a vehicle;

[0008] The oil tank cover receiving device connecting port is arranged below the oil tank cover receiving support, and a clamping part is arranged at the bottom of the oil tank cover receiving device connecting port, which is used for mounting the oil tank cover receiving bracket on the body of the oil gun.

[0009] Further, a bracket guard plate is arranged on the oil tank cover receiving support, and the bracket guard plate is connected to the top end of the oil tank cover receiving support at the bottom of the bracket guard plate, which is used for improving the stability of the oil tank cover receiving support in placing the oil tank cover.

[0010] Further, a bracket clamping groove is arranged at the top end of the bracket guard plate, and the inner diameter of the bracket clamping groove is smaller than the inner diameter of the bracket guard plate, which is used for preventing the oil tank cover from sliding off from the top end.

[0011] Further, the oil tank cover receiving device connecting port is provided with a "inverted U-shaped" opening, and the inner diameter of the "inverted U-shaped" opening is matched with the outer diameter of the tail part of the body of the oil gun, and the oil tank cover receiving device connecting port is clamped and mounted on the tail part of the body of the oil gun.

[0012] Further, a counterbore is arranged on the opening of the oil tank cover receiving device connecting port, and the counterbore is hexagonal, and the oil tank cover receiving device connecting port is fixed on the tail part of the body of the oil gun by tightening the bolt and the nut, so as to ensure the reliability and safety of the whole device during use.

[0013] Further, a support recess is arranged in the oil tank cover receiving support, which is used for receiving the gasoline remaining on the oil tank cover and flowing downward, so as to avoid the gasoline from being scattered everywhere, to keep the surrounding environment clean, and to eliminate the safety hazards possibly caused by the random flowing of the gasoline to a certain extent, and to play a role in reasonably collecting and properly handling the gasoline.

[0014] Further, the inner diameter of the bracket guard plate is matched with the outer diameter of the oil tank cover sealing gasket.

[0015] Further, the oil tank cover receiving bracket is made of conductive material, which prevents static electricity from causing safety accidents.

[0016] Further, the oil tank cover receiving support is a semicircular structure, and the inner diameter of the semicircular structure is matched with the size of the common oil tank cover of a vehicle, so as to facilitate the placement of the oil tank cover of the vehicle.

[0017] Working principle: before the device works temporarily, the fuel tank cap storage bracket 6 is fixedly installed on the gun body of the oil gun; when the vehicle enters the gas station, the oil gun with the installed fuel tank cap storage bracket 6 is held by the oiler to approach the vehicle fuel tank for oiling, and the fuel tank cap storage bracket 6 on the gun body of the oil gun enters the working state. The fuel tank cap storage bearing platform 61 on the fuel tank cap storage bracket 6 is a semicircular structure, and the outer diameter of the automobile fuel tank cap is matched. After the owner or the oiler unscrews the fuel tank cap, the fuel tank cap is naturally aligned with the semicircular opening, and the fuel tank cap can be smoothly placed in the fuel tank cap storage bracket 6 and placed on the fuel tank cap storage bearing platform 61.

[0018] After the fuel tank cap enters the inside of the storage bracket 6, the fuel tank cap sealing ring is attached to the inner wall of the bracket guard plate 8, the bracket guard plate 8 forms a semi-enclosed protection, the bracket guard plate 8 forms a semi-enclosed protection for the fuel tank cap, effectively avoids the displacement of the fuel tank cap due to various shaking during oiling, and the bracket clamping groove 81 is arranged at the top of the bracket guard plate 8, the inner diameter of the bracket clamping groove 81 is smaller than the inner diameter of the bracket guard plate 8, and after the fuel tank cap enters the inside of the storage bracket 6, the edge of the fuel tank cap can be embedded in the bracket clamping groove 61, so that the fuel tank cap is prevented from sliding off from the top. During the subsequent entire oiling operation, the fuel tank cap will be firmly clamped in the bracket clamping groove 61, and even if the oil gun shakes due to normal oiling action, the fuel tank cap will not fall down and always be in a stable storage state.

[0019] After the oiling is completed, the owner or the oiler takes out the fuel tank cap from the semicircular opening of the storage bracket 6 and re-installs the fuel tank cap on the vehicle fuel tank. At this time, the entire fuel tank cap storage device enters the standby state and is ready for the next use, so as to circularly and efficiently serve each oiling operation of the gas station.

[0042] The technical solution will now be described in detail with reference to the accompanying drawings of the embodiments of this utility model.

[0043] Example 1

[0044] like Figure 4 , 5 As shown, a temporary storage device for a car fuel tank cap at a gas station includes a fuel tank cap storage bracket 6 installed on the fuel nozzle body, comprising: a fuel nozzle body 1, a fuel nozzle trigger 2, an inlet pipe 3, an outlet pipe 4, an outlet nozzle 5, a fuel tank cap storage bracket 6, a fuel tank cap storage support 61, a fuel tank cap storage device connection port 7, a countersunk hole 71, a bolt 72, a nut 73, a bracket guard plate 8, a bracket slot 81, a fuel tank cap 9, a fuel tank cap sealing gasket 91, and a car 10.

[0045] like Figure 4 As shown, the fuel tank cap receiving platform 61 has a semi-circular structure and is used to hold the automotive fuel tank cap. A bracket guard plate 8 is mounted on the fuel tank cap receiving platform 61, with its bottom connected to the top of the platform, to improve the stability of the fuel tank cap. The inner diameter of the bracket guard plate 8 is designed to match the outer diameter of the fuel tank cap sealing gasket. A bracket slot 81 is located at the top of the bracket guard plate 8, with an inner diameter smaller than that of the bracket guard plate 8, to prevent the fuel tank cap from slipping off the top.

[0046] like Figure 4 As shown, the fuel tank cap storage device connection port 7 is located below the fuel tank cap storage support 61. The fuel tank cap storage device connection port 7 has an inverted U-shaped opening. The inner diameter of the inverted U-shaped opening is adapted to the outer diameter of the fuel nozzle body. The fuel tank cap storage device connection port 7 is snapped onto the fuel nozzle body.

[0047] like Figure 5 As shown, the opening of the fuel tank cap storage device connection port 7 is provided with a countersunk hole 71. The countersunk hole 71 is hexagonal. By tightening the bolts and nuts, the fuel tank cap storage device connection port 7 is fixed to the tail of the fuel nozzle body, ensuring the reliability and safety of the entire device during use.

[0048] The fuel tank cap storage bracket 6 is made of conductive material to prevent static electricity from causing safety accidents.

[0049] like Figure 1 As shown, before the temporary fuel tank cap storage device at the gas station is activated, the fuel tank cap storage bracket 6 is fixedly installed on the fuel nozzle body 1. When a vehicle enters the gas station, and the gas station attendant approaches the vehicle's fuel tank with the fuel nozzle equipped with the fuel tank cap storage bracket 6, the fuel tank cap storage bracket 6 on the fuel nozzle body 1 immediately enters its working state. The fuel tank cap storage platform 61 on the fuel tank cap storage bracket 6 has a semi-circular structure, which is compatible with the outer diameter of the car's fuel tank cap 9. After the car owner or gas station attendant unscrews the fuel tank cap 9, there is no need to adjust the angle. Simply align the fuel tank cap 9 naturally with the semi-circular opening, and the fuel tank cap 9 will smoothly enter the fuel tank cap storage bracket 6 and be placed on the fuel tank cap storage platform 61, thanks to the fit between the opening and its own height.

[0050] After the fuel tank cap 9 is inserted into the storage bracket 6, the fuel tank cap sealing gasket 91 fits against the inner wall of the bracket guard plate 8, forming a semi-enclosed protection. This semi-enclosed protection effectively prevents the fuel tank cap 9 from shifting due to various movements during refueling. The top of the bracket guard plate 8 has a bracket slot 61 with an inner diameter smaller than that of the bracket guard plate 8. After the fuel tank cap 9 is inserted into the storage bracket 6, its edge fits perfectly into the bracket slot 61, preventing it from slipping off. Throughout the subsequent refueling process, the fuel tank cap 9 remains firmly held in the bracket slot 61. Even if the refueling nozzle shakes during normal refueling, the fuel tank cap 9 will not fall off and will always remain in a stable, stored state.

[0051] After refueling, the car owner or gas station attendant removes the fuel tank cap 9 from the semi-circular opening of the storage tray 6 and then puts it back into the vehicle's fuel tank. At this point, the entire fuel tank cap storage device is ready for the next use, and this cycle repeats efficiently and conveniently for every refueling operation at the gas station.

[0052] Example 2

[0053] like Figure 7 As shown, the difference from Embodiment 1 is that the fuel tank cap receiving platform 61 is provided with a platform recess 62 inside, which is used to collect the gasoline that remains on the fuel tank cap 9 and flows down.

[0054] The usage steps are the same as in Example 1. After the fuel tank cap 9 enters the storage bracket 6, the gasoline on its surface will naturally flow downward under the action of gravity and converge into the support recess 62 inside. The gasoline is safely stored in the support recess 62, which is convenient for staff to clean up.
